On April 6, 1971, President Richard M. Nixon and H. R. ("Bob") Haldeman met in the President's office in the Old Executive Office Building at 9:59 am. The Old Executive Office Building taping system captured this recording, which is known as Conversation 245-003 of the White House Tapes.
